Design and Build Quality
Both the Martenit Ultrasonic Toothbrush and the Snefe Ultrasonic Electric Toothbrush feature a unique U-shaped design aimed at enhancing cleaning efficiency. The Martenit toothbrush is crafted from food-grade environmentally friendly silicone, ensuring comfort and ease of use. It also boasts a washable feature, allowing for convenient maintenance. In contrast, the Snefe toothbrush also utilizes food-grade silicone but emphasizes its soft bristles for a gentler touch on the gums. While both designs are aimed at maximizing oral hygiene, the Martenit offers a slightly more robust build with its emphasis on water resistance and travel suitability.
Cleaning Technology
When it comes to cleaning technology, both toothbrushes leverage ultrasonic vibrations for effective plaque removal. The Martenit toothbrush claims to provide three times the cleanliness of a traditional toothbrush, while the Snefe toothbrush offers a complete 360-degree cleaning in just 45 seconds. The Martenit features four cleaning modes tailored to various needs, such as deep cleaning and gum care. On the other hand, the Snefe toothbrush also provides four modes, including a gentle massage option. This indicates that while both models offer versatility, the Martenit may provide a more comprehensive approach to dental care.

Waterproof Rating
The Snefe Ultrasonic Electric Toothbrush boasts an IPX7 waterproof rating, allowing it to be used in the shower or bath without worry. This feature may appeal to users looking for versatility in their oral hygiene routine. The Martenit toothbrush, while also water-resistant, does not specify a waterproof rating. This distinction could be pivotal for consumers who prioritize using their toothbrush in wet environments, making the Snefe a more suitable option for those users.
